Enjoy some games and build up camaraderie with your fellow players at the Meridian Senior Center’s regular game day. Although playing games might seem like an activity reserved for children, studies have shown that adults can have significant benefits from gameplay, such as stress relief, mental stimulation and improved energy.
Chess, Cribbage, Hand & Foot. From 10 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. FREE. Meridian Senior Center, 4406 Okemos Road Okemos.
